The Rice Moth [Corcyra Cephalonica Stainton], by Frank Hurlbut Chittenden, offers a detailed examination of a common agricultural pest. This early 20th-century study provides valuable insights into the biology, behavior, and control of the rice moth, an insect known for infesting stored grains and other food products. Chittenden’s work is a significant contribution to the field of economic entomology, presenting practical strategies for minimizing crop damage and protecting food supplies.
